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?
Although annotations already mark the tool as destructive, the description adds meaningful behavioral context: deletion is permanent and irreversible. It also discloses bulk execution support via ad_ids, which goes beyond the structured annotations.

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?
Schema description coverage is 0%, so the description must compensate for parameter ambiguity. It only explains ad_ids for batching and does not clarify the relationship between ad_id and ad_ids, nor the purpose of auth_account. This leaves key invocation semantics underspecified.

Many tools are near-identical variants of the same action, with only a `[Flattened action]` marker distinguishing e.g. the four `meta_ads_campaign_write_*` tools and the three `meta_ads_creative_write_*` tools. The reporting tools also overlap: `meta_ads_ads`, `meta_ads_realtime`, `meta_ads_today`, and `meta_ads_roas` all return spend/performance data, making selection genuinely ambiguous. Unrelated platform tools like `marketplace` and `toolkit_info` are mixed in, further muddying what the server is for.
Most Meta Ads tools follow a readable `meta_ads_<resource>_<action>` snake_case convention, and write actions are reasonably predictable. However, there are inconsistencies: `meta_ads_ads` vs `meta_ads_audience`, `meta_ads_business_list` vs `meta_ads_business_accounts` vs `meta_ads_list_accounts`, and `meta_ads_adset_delete` vs the `meta_ads_adset_write_*` grouping. The unbranded platform tools (`connect`, `report_bug`, `show_version`) also break the pattern.
44 tools is far above the recommended range and pushes the server into unwieldy territory. The count is inflated because flattened actions were expanded into separate tools: the campaign write tool appears four times, audience write twice, adset create/update twice, creative tools three times, media upload three times, and business/pages actions once per variant. A consolidated action-based design could reduce real surface area to roughly 15-20 tools.
The core Meta Ads lifecycle is well covered: campaigns, ad sets, creatives/ads, custom audiences, media upload, business managers, pages, and reporting all have create/read/update/delete or equivalent destinations. The main gaps are no direct `list_ad_sets` tool, no `remove_users` for audiences, and an apparent reference to a nonexistent `meta_ads_media` tool for listing uploaded media. These are noticeable but usually workaroundable.
